Let’s Have A Moment Of Science ID: 1632711262434

Let’s Have A Moment Of Science ID: 1632711262434

$0.00

(Downloads - 1)

Description

Let’s Have A Moment Of Science

Reviews

There are no reviews yet.

Be the first to review “Let’s Have A Moment Of Science ID: 1632711262434”